编程走方格游戏叫什么名字
-
编程走方格游戏的名字可以叫做"方格迷宫"或者"方格探险"。
1年前 -
编程走方格游戏通常被称为迷宫游戏或走迷宫游戏。在这种游戏中,玩家需要通过编程指令来控制角色在方格迷宫中移动并找到出口。这种游戏可以帮助玩家培养逻辑思维、问题解决能力和编程技巧。以下是关于迷宫游戏的一些重要知识点:
-
游戏目标:迷宫游戏的目标是通过编程指令将角色移动到迷宫的出口。在达到目标之前,玩家需要解决一系列的迷题和难题。
-
编程语言:迷宫游戏通常使用类似于图形化编程语言或者伪代码的编程语言来控制角色的移动。这种语言通常包含一系列的指令,例如前进、后退、转向等。
-
迷宫设计:迷宫的设计对于游戏的难度和乐趣起着至关重要的作用。迷宫的结构可以是简单的方格,也可以是复杂的路径和障碍物的组合。迷宫还可以包含陷阱、宝藏、门等元素,增加游戏的挑战性。
-
游戏难度:迷宫游戏通常有多个难度级别供玩家选择。初级难度通常包含简单的迷宫和少量的编程指令,适合初学者。中级和高级难度则会增加迷宫的复杂性和编程的挑战。
-
学习编程:迷宫游戏是学习编程的一种有趣的方式。通过解决迷题和编写程序来控制角色移动,玩家可以学习到编程的基本概念和技巧,例如循环、条件判断和函数等。这种学习方式可以激发玩家的兴趣,并帮助他们更好地理解和掌握编程知识。
总之,迷宫游戏是一种有趣且具有教育意义的编程游戏。通过解决迷题和编写程序,玩家可以培养逻辑思维、问题解决能力和编程技巧。这种游戏不仅适合初学者学习编程,也可以挑战有经验的程序员。
1年前 -
-
编程走方格游戏可以叫做迷宫游戏或者寻路游戏。在这个游戏中,玩家需要通过编写代码来控制游戏角色在一个方格迷宫中移动,达到指定的目标位置。编程走方格游戏不仅可以锻炼编程思维和逻辑推理能力,还可以培养解决问题的能力和团队合作精神。下面将介绍如何编程实现一个简单的迷宫游戏。
1. 准备工作
在开始编程之前,需要准备一个方格迷宫地图,地图中包含起点、终点和障碍物。可以使用二维数组或者字符串来表示迷宫地图,其中不同的字符代表不同的元素(如起点、终点、障碍物、空白等)。还需要选择一种编程语言(如Python、Java、C++等)来实现游戏逻辑。2. 游戏角色控制
游戏角色可以是一个小人、动物或者其他形象,玩家需要通过编写代码来控制角色的移动。可以使用键盘输入或者鼠标点击来控制角色的移动方向,也可以通过编写代码来实现自动寻路算法。3. 移动规则
在编程走方格游戏中,需要定义角色的移动规则。角色可以向上、向下、向左、向右四个方向移动,但是不能穿过障碍物。当角色移动到终点位置时,游戏结束。4. 碰撞检测
在角色移动过程中,需要进行碰撞检测,判断角色是否与障碍物发生碰撞。如果发生碰撞,角色不能继续移动,需要改变移动方向或者选择其他路径。5. 寻路算法
如果希望实现自动寻路功能,可以使用一些经典的寻路算法,如广度优先搜索(BFS)、深度优先搜索(DFS)或者A*算法。这些算法可以帮助角色找到从起点到终点的最短路径。6. 游戏界面
为了增加游戏的可玩性和视觉效果,可以设计一个简单的游戏界面。界面可以包含迷宫地图、角色、起点、终点等元素。还可以添加背景音乐、游戏计时器等功能来提升游戏体验。7. 游戏扩展
在实现基本功能之后,可以考虑对游戏进行扩展,添加更多的关卡、难度级别、道具或者其他游戏元素。还可以设计一些特殊的地图,如迷宫中有传送门、陷阱、隐藏路径等。编程走方格游戏是一种有趣且具有挑战性的编程项目,通过编写代码来控制角色的移动,不仅可以提升编程能力,还可以培养解决问题的能力和创造力。不同的编程语言和算法可以实现不同的游戏效果,希望以上内容能够对你有所帮助。
1年前